Asking for some prayers for my oldest dog and me.

It's time for Raven, and I'm leaving in an hour to have her euthanized. I will be there with her, and hope her passing is peaceful.

I have been incredibly blessed to have her with me for over 4 1/2 years now, when my vet gave only gave her a year on the meds for congestive heart failure because she was in such bad shape when AD brought her to my house. I told AD enough was enough, and Raven was here to stay for the remainder of her life. She had been drug all over the country and back.

She turned 16 1/2 in October.

This marks 3 dogs in my household this year...Pikachu, my little wire-haired terrier in February to cancer, Toby (Amber's dog) to kidney disease just a few weeks ago, and now Raven.

Please think good thoughts and send prayers our way.
